Nakuru Court Orders Arrest of Uasin Gishu Governor and Three Others

A Nakuru Magistrate’s Court has issued an immediate arrest warrant for Uasin Gishu Governor Jonathan Bii and three others.

Senior Principal Magistrate Peter Ndege authorized the warrants for Bii, former Uasin Gishu Deputy Governor John Barorot, Edwin Bett, Hilary Ruto, and Stephen Lel after they failed to appear in court.

The individuals were expected to testify today in a case involving Uasin Gishu Senator Meshack Rono and two former county officials, Joshua Lelei and Meshack Rono, who face ten fraud-related charges. These charges include stealing Sh1.1 billion from parents through the fraudulent Finland Education Program, as well as conspiracy, theft, abuse of office, and forgery.

The prosecution alleges that the Sh1.1 billion, which was deposited into the Uasin Gishu Overseas Education Fund account, was misappropriated.

Prosecutor Angeline Chinga stated that the five witnesses had been formally summoned but did not show up as required. Defense attorneys criticized the absence of prosecution witnesses, highlighting the financial burden on their clients who traveled to Nakuru for a hearing that was postponed.

The magistrate has also summoned Mercy Tarus, a key witness, after the Investigating Officer reported difficulty in reaching her.
